From Broadcasts to Conversations

Traditional marketing, where a passive audience is bombarded with a unidirectional advertisement is now outdated. 

Branding strategies that focus on conversation and two-way data streams are taking over. Customers on search engines and social media, and content platforms are able to choose their attention. Modern strategies focus on active listening, engagement and understanding trends within audience needs.

Three Pillars of Modern Digital Marketing

1. Content That Educates

Modern audiences are most selective. They ask for content that is informative and quench their curiosity. 

Trust is cultivated with tutorial and blogging content that clarifies and aids understanding. 

The learner-centered approach, as taken by Click N Learn, will help in converting a passive audience in to an engaged audience.

2. Data that Directs Us

Analytics in digital marketing is like a compass. However, unless analyzed properly, raw data is of little to no use. 

For example, the SEO Executive understands content performance not just by volume, but by the engagement and the time spent on it, as well as the click-through rates. 

Google Analytics and Search Console are good starting places. 

3. Experience that Brings Users Back 

User experience and SEO are two sides of the same coin.

Fast loading websites, clean and simple formats, and good internal linking increase user dwell time, which increases the speed of indexing. 

Design and information flow are harmonized to the benefit of the users, and the search engines in the end.

The Changing Role of the SEO Executive  

The days of jamming keywords or building low-quality backlinks are long gone.  

Today’s SEO professional is a strategic editor who integrates site storytelling and site optimization.  

The primary goals of SEO strategists are:  
  • Identifying the underlying search intent of each query.  
  • Organizing content around useful subtopics.  
  • Acquiring relevant, natural backlinks.  
  • Maintaining clean pages (mobile-friendly and quick loading).
